Puppies with urinary incontinence have lost the ability to control their bladder. Incontinent pups may urinate frequently and have little control while starting and stopping. Pups may also uncontrollably urinate when stressed, fearful or excited. Often, your puppy will not realize he is voiding.

Submissive peeing is normal for dogs to show that they aren’t a threat to you. They will often lie on their backs and show you their tummies. Excited pups may pee just because they are happy to see you, but plenty of other things can cause excited peeing: going on a walk, meeting a new furry pal, or even being rewarded with a favorite treat. The puppy gets so excited when he sees his owner that he loses control of his bladder. The puppy is not aware of or able to control this and punishment will confuse him and is not fair to him. Often dogs outgrow this problem as they mature and gain control of the muscles that control peeing. The latter behavior is known as submission peeing. Dogs with these behaviors tend to display them during physical contact, when greeting new arrivals, playing or if the dog is being reprimanded. If your dog is submission peeing, you are more likely to see him averting his eyes, cringe, cower, roll over or flatten his ears. Submissive urination is normal canine communication. Dogs do it to show social appeasement. When a dog submissively urinates, he’s trying to convey that he’s not a threat. Not all dogs submissively urinate. However, some will urinate when they’re exceptionally excited or feeling submissive or intimidated. If your precious pooch has an unpleasant habit of peeing whenever she's excited, don't assume that the problem will necessarily go away with a little time. There's an important distinction between adult dogs and puppies where vomiting is concerned. Mild vomiting in an adult dog may warrant a wait-and-see approach, but vomiting in a very young dog is always potentially serious because puppies may quickly become dehydrated and lose critical electrolytes. Don't wait too long to take a vomiting puppy to the vet. When a puppy becomes overexcited, or when something frightens her, it’s normal for the pup to release a few drops of urine. Not all puppies do this, but many do. It happens because overexcitement or fear may cause the pup to momentarily lose control of the muscles that close the urinary bladder, which allows a small.
